What the document says

“Section 163(j)(8)(A)(v) is amended by striking "in the case of taxable years beginning before January 1, 2022,".”

To provide for reconciliation pursuant to title II of H. Con. Res. 14, Sec. 70303

The section strikes the words in the case of taxable years beginning before January 1, 2022 from section 163(j)(8)(A)(v) of the Internal Revenue Code of 1986. That provision is not indexed here, so this record states the change and stops.
